Suddenly, a win2k install stopped working. It starts up, but then an error
about "explorer.exe has generated errors" or such and windows stops working.

I tried replacing the explorer.exe with the same file from another win2k
install, but that didn't help.

We can start in safe mode, but that's about all.

Got any ideas out there??

Even tried a restore to last known good config. Didn't work, either.

The fact that you can load up in Safe Mode usually means that there is some
kind of 3rd-party software interfering with normal operation.
Try disabling 3rd-party browser extensions in IE:
Tools > Internet Options > Advanced > Enable third-party browser
extensions (requires restart)
